Compare ADATA XPG LANCER RGB 32 GB (2 x 16GB) DDR5-6000 White vs XPG LANCER RGB 32GB (2 x 16GB) DDR5 6800 White

ADATA XPG LANCER RGB 32 GB (2 x 16GB) DDR5-6000 White and ADATA XPG LANCER RGB 32GB (2 x 16GB) DDR5 6800 White are both memory with the same Size (32GB (2 x 16GB)), First Word Latency (10 ns) and LED Color (RGB). The main differences are in Speed, CAS Latency and Voltage.

Comparison and key differences summary

Reasons to buy the ADATA XPG LANCER RGB 32 GB (2 x 16GB) DDR5-6000 White:

  • Less voltage required (-0.05 V needed)
  • Less CAS latency (-4)

Reasons to buy the ADATA XPG LANCER RGB 32GB (2 x 16GB) DDR5 6800 White:

  • Higher speed frequency (+800 MHz)
